快点阅读为什么服务器出错
-
服务器出错的原因有很多种,下面将从以下几个方面进行介绍。
首先,硬件故障是服务器出错的常见原因之一。例如,硬盘故障、内存故障、电源故障等都可能导致服务器无法正常工作。这些硬件故障往往需要及时诊断和更换相关设备才能解决。
其次,软件问题也会导致服务器出错。服务器上的操作系统或应用程序可能存在漏洞或错误,导致服务器无法正常运行。此外,服务器软件的配置错误或冲突也可能引起服务器故障。因此,及时更新和维护服务器的软件是保持服务器稳定运行的重要步骤。
第三,网络问题也是服务器出错的常见原因。网络故障可能导致服务器无法与其他设备或网络通信,从而影响其正常运行。网络问题可以包括物理连接故障、路由器配置错误、网络拥堵等。解决网络问题需要仔细检查服务器和网络设备的连接状态,并进行必要的设置和调整。
此外,安全性问题也可能导致服务器出错。服务器可能受到恶意攻击或网络病毒的侵害,导致服务中断或数据泄漏。因此,保护服务器的安全性是非常重要的。定期更新安全补丁、设置强密码、使用防火墙等措施都可以提高服务器的安全性。
最后,负载过大也会导致服务器出错。当服务器的负载超过其承载能力时,会出现性能下降、响应延迟等问题。因此,根据服务器的实际情况进行合理的负载均衡和优化是保证服务器正常运行的重要措施。
总之,服务器出错的原因多种多样,硬件故障、软件问题、网络问题、安全问题和负载过大都可能导致服务器无法正常工作。定期维护、及时更新和保护服务器的安全性等措施是确保服务器稳定运行的关键。
1年前 -
为什么服务器出错是一个常见的问题,可能有多个原因。下面将介绍一些常见的服务器错误以及可能导致这些错误的原因。
-
服务器负载过高:当服务器同时处理过多的请求时,会超出其处理能力,从而导致服务器出错。这可能是由于高流量或请求频率过高所致,也可能是由于服务器硬件性能不足或配置不正确导致的。
-
资源耗尽:服务器所需的资源包括 CPU、内存、带宽和磁盘空间等。当其中任何一种资源耗尽时,服务器都可能出错。例如,如果服务器的内存不足,它可能无法处理更多的请求,从而导致出错。
-
网络问题:服务器与客户端之间的通信是通过网络进行的。如果网络出现问题,如断开连接、网络延迟或网络故障,服务器可能无法正常响应请求,导致出错。
-
软件错误:服务器上运行的软件可能存在错误或漏洞,这些错误或漏洞可能导致服务器出错。例如,一个 Bug 导致服务器未能正确处理请求,或者一个安全漏洞被利用来攻击服务器。
-
配置错误:服务器的配置文件中可能存在错误,例如错误的权限设置、错误的端口配置、无效的 SSL 证书等。这些配置错误可能导致服务器无法正常运行,从而出错。
为了解决服务器出错的问题,可以采取以下措施:
-
扩大服务器资源:如果服务器负载过高或资源不足,可以考虑升级服务器的硬件或增加额外的资源,如 CPU、内存、带宽等。
-
优化服务器配置:检查服务器的配置文件,确保其正确设置,并根据需要进行修改。例如,优化缓存设置、调整连接超时时间等。
-
更新软件版本:定期更新服务器上运行的软件版本,以获取最新的功能和修复已知的错误和漏洞。
-
监控服务器状态:使用监控工具来实时监测服务器的状态,例如 CPU 使用率、内存使用率、网络流量等,以便及时发现问题并采取相应的措施。
-
充分测试和备份:在对服务器进行任何更改之前,先进行充分的测试,并确保有可靠的备份,以防出现意外情况。
总而言之,服务器出错可能有多种原因,如负载过高、资源耗尽、网络问题、软件错误和配置错误等。为了解决这些问题,可以采取相应的措施,如扩大服务器资源、优化服务器配置、更新软件版本、监控服务器状态和充分测试和备份等。
1年前 -
-
标题:为什么服务器会出错?
导言:服务器作为网络服务的核心设备,承担着处理请求、存储数据和提供服务的重要任务。然而,由于各种原因,服务器也会出现各种错误。本文将从硬件故障、软件问题、网络连接、安全漏洞、负载过高等方面,探讨服务器出错的原因及解决方法。
一、硬件故障导致服务器出错
- 电源故障:电源是服务器正常工作的基础,如果电源出现故障,服务器将无法正常启动或者突然断电。解决方法:确保电源供应稳定,并使用UPS等设备提供备用电源。
- 内存故障:内存是服务器处理数据的关键组件,如果内存出现故障,会导致服务器崩溃或运行缓慢。解决方法:定期检查内存状态,及时更换故障内存颗粒。
- 硬盘故障:硬盘是服务器存储数据的设备,如果硬盘损坏或容量不足,将导致数据丢失或无法访问。解决方法:进行硬盘检测和定期备份数据,及时更换故障硬盘。
- CPU故障:CPU是服务器的计算核心,如果CPU故障,会导致服务器性能下降或无法启动。解决方法:检查CPU温度、风扇是否正常工作,及时更换故障CPU。
二、软件问题导致服务器出错
- 操作系统错误:操作系统是服务器运行的基础软件,如果操作系统文件损坏或设置错误,将导致服务器不能正常启动。解决方法:及时更新操作系统补丁,定期检查系统文件完整性。
- 应用程序错误:应用程序是服务器提供服务的核心,如果应用程序代码有bug或设置错误,会导致服务器出错或服务无法正常运作。解决方法:进行软件更新、修复bug,并通过定期检查和性能测试来确保应用程序稳定运行。
- 数据库错误:数据库是服务器存储和管理数据的关键软件,如果数据库配置有误、索引丢失或存储空间不足,会导致数据库访问慢或服务中断。解决方法:对数据库进行性能优化、数据清理和备份,定期维护和监控数据库运行情况。
三、网络连接问题导致服务器出错
- 网络故障:网络连接是服务器与用户终端之间的桥梁,如果网络出现断开或者延迟,将导致服务器无法正常响应用户请求。解决方法:定期检查网络设备状态、升级网络设备固件,确保网络连接畅通。
- 带宽不足:带宽是服务器处理请求的速度,如果带宽不足,会导致服务器响应缓慢或服务不可用。解决方法:增加带宽容量或者进行负载均衡,确保服务器能够处理更多的请求。
- DNS解析错误:DNS解析是将域名转换为IP地址的过程,如果DNS解析出错,会导致服务器无法找到对应的网站或服务。解决方法:检查DNS配置,确保解析正确并使用可靠的DNS服务器。
四、安全漏洞导致服务器出错
- 网络攻击:黑客利用安全漏洞对服务器进行攻击,可能导致数据泄露、服务中断或服务器瘫痪。解决方法:定期更新服务器软件补丁,配置防火墙和入侵检测系统,加强服务器安全防护。
- 密码泄露:如果服务器管理员密码泄露,黑客可以获取服务器管理权限,对服务器进行攻击或非法操作。解决方法:定期更换管理员密码,并使用强密码策略保护密码安全。
- 弱点利用:服务器上运行的软件可能存在安全漏洞,黑客可以利用这些漏洞进行攻击。解决方法:及时更新软件补丁、关闭不必要的服务和端口,加强服务器安全配置。
五、负载过高导致服务器出错
- 高并发请求:服务器承载的请求过多,超过服务器的负载能力,导致服务器响应缓慢或服务中断。解决方法:增加服务器的处理能力,进行负载均衡和流量调度,优化请求处理逻辑。
- DDOS攻击:黑客通过模拟大量请求对服务器进行DDOS攻击,使服务器资源耗尽,导致服务无法正常运作。解决方法:配置防火墙和入侵检测系统,进行流量限制和封锁恶意IP。
- 内存泄露:应用程序内存管理不当导致内存泄露,占用过多内存资源,使服务器运行缓慢或崩溃。解决方法:优化代码逻辑,设置合理的内存使用限制,并定期检查和释放内存资源。
结论:服务器出错的原因有很多,可以从硬件故障、软件问题、网络连接、安全漏洞以及负载过高等多个方面来考虑。对于服务器出错,解决方法则需根据具体问题来进行相应的调整和处理,保障服务器的稳定运行。
1年前